A number of seals and seal impressions dated the first quar ter of second millennium B.C., were found in Kültepe, whose the capital city of Assyrian Trade Colonies in Anatolia. They are in different styles; Akkadian, Third Dynasty of Ur, Isin-Larsa, Old Babylonian, Old Assyrian, Old Syrian and Anatolian. The largest groups of impressions are in Old Assyrian and Anatolian styles. This thesis has taken Old Assyrian stye and depended on publis hed and especially unpublished material that found at Kültepe and the other contemporary Anatolian and Mesopotamian cities. All seals and impressions in Old Assyrian style, has catalo gued and drawn. Drawings have completed with different impress - ions of some seals. It has worked to find that the owners of seals. Owners of seals have written in catalogue. In this thesis, Old Assyrian Glyptic were brought up development in levels of Kaneş-Karum. Figures were compared with related other Mesopotamian styles. Old Asyrian Glyptic have been differentiated into two levels (II and lb) at Kült epe. According to the development of the Old Assyrian Style, there are two different phases in the Level II. Early phase of Old Assyrian Glyptic has adopted style of Third Dynayty of Ur Period. But Assyrian seal cutters have developed own style and created a lot of new subjects and figures at the end of the Third Dynasty of Ur Period. Impressions on an envelope that found at Tell Harmal, reign of Sumuabum (about reign of Erishum I), have proved to begin this phase in begining of Level II. In the second phase of Level II material of the Old Assyrian Glyptic, adopts several iconographical types from Anatolian art, and seals were finely cutted. In Level of lb, it occurs seals that known from the Level II and in addition to a new group seals. New group seals were called“Provincial Babylonian”that were found especially Mesopotamia, because of Assyrian seal cutters copies Old Babylonian seals. Thus seals of Shamshi-Adad I., his officials and city of Assur were cutted also in Old Babylonian Style. There is another group seals which called“Shematic Assyri an”is not development of Old Assyrian Glyptic.
